Working Principles

The TPA122D is a Class D audio amplifier, which uses pulse-width modulation (PWM) to amplify the audio signal. It converts the analog audio input into a digital signal and then uses a switching circuit to generate a high-frequency PWM waveform. This PWM waveform is then filtered and amplified to produce the final audio output.
